2f6f3bd1bde6e0ac34f81a2d115f45c3070d51cca02de17a3c6d5ad613705500

2068310 (336 blocks ago)

442666019

⏴ Block 2068309 (2ca40b27...d68) | Block 2068311 ⏵ | Latest block ⏭

Metadata

17/3/26, 7:42 am UTC (11:13:07 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 31.8152 SENT

Transactions (0)

Show raw details